The Northwest Washington Fair will return to Lynden this summer with another year of grandstand entertainment and concerts.

This year’s fair will run from Aug. 7-16 at the Northwest Washington Fairgrounds and will feature live concerts by American country singer Jake Owen and Chandler Moore, a Grammy-winning Christian music singer and part of Maverick City Music, a Christian music group.

Now the NW WA Fair has announced another Grandstand Entertainment concert coming this summer: ZZ Top.

ZZ Top, a “legendary rock band” that formed in 1969, will perform at the fair at 7 p.m. Saturday, Aug. 16, according to a news release from the Northwest Washington Fair.

The band features Billy Gibbons, Frank Beard and new bassist Elwood Francis, who joined the band in 2021 after longtime member Dusty Hill passed away.

“Their third album, 1973’s Tres Hombres, catapulted them to national attention with the hit ‘La Grange,’ still one of the band’s signature pieces today,” the news release states. Eliminator, their 1983 album, was something of a paradigm shift for ZZ Top. Their roots blues skew was intact but added to the mix were tech-age trappings that soon found a visual outlet with such tracks as ‘Sharp Dressed Man’ and ‘Legs’ on the then up-and-coming MTV.”

“It was one of the music industry’s first albums to have been certified Diamond, far beyond Gold and Platinum, and a reflection of US domestic sales exceeding 10 million units,” the news release states.

Concert tickets will go on sale at 9 a.m. Wednesday, March 26 for the fair’s email list subscribers, and Friday, March 28 for the general public.

Tickets cost $50 for grandstand reserved seats, $65 for grandstand preferred and $75 for preferred chairs. Ticket prices do not include fair admission.

Tickets are available online by calling 360-354-4111 or at the fair office at 1775 Front St. in Lynden.
